Understanding Your Home’s Aesthetic

Before selecting a carpet, it's essential to understand the existing aesthetics of your home. Are your interiors modern and minimalist, or do they lean more towards classic charm? Consider the color palette, furniture style, and lighting in your rooms. These elements play a crucial role in determining the kind of carpet that will enhance your space. A modern home with sleek furniture and cool tones might benefit from a carpet in neutral shades or with geometric patterns, while a rustic, country home might call for rich, warm hues and textured designs.

Carpet Colors and Patterns

The color of your carpet can dramatically impact the ambiance of a room. Light-colored carpets can make a space appear larger and more open, which is ideal for small rooms or places with limited natural light. Darker carpets add a layer of coziness and sophistication and are perfect for larger areas or rooms where you want to create a more intimate atmosphere. Patterns also play a role; subtle patterns can add texture without overwhelming, while bolder patterns can become a focal point in a room with simpler furnishings.

Material Matters

Choosing the right material is as important as selecting the color and pattern. Carpets come in a variety of materials, each with unique properties. Wool carpets offer durability and a luxurious feel, making them ideal for high-traffic areas. For those on a budget, synthetic fibers like nylon or polyester can offer practical solutions without sacrificing style. Consider the traffic in each room—high-use areas like the living room or hallway will benefit from more durable materials, whereas bedrooms can accommodate softer, more luxurious fibers.

Practical Considerations

When matching a carpet with your home, it’s crucial to think about lifestyle. If you have young children or pets, stain resistance should be a top priority. Look for carpets treated with stain protection technology, or consider options with patterns that naturally hide dirt and blemishes. Remember that some carpets require more maintenance than others, so be sure to factor in the time and resources you’re willing to dedicate to carpet care.
